What Is COB Packaging Technology?
COB packaging involves directly mounting LED chips onto a PCB substrate, connecting them electrically via wire bonding, and encapsulating them with resin to form a complete display unit. Unlike traditional SMD packaging, COB eliminates the need for separate lamp bead manufacturing and soldering, simplifying the production process while significantly enhancing heat dissipation.
This advanced technology offers moisture-proof, anti-static, and anti-collision properties, reducing dead pixel issues and making it ideal for the era of high-definition, small-pitch displays.
Key Advantages of COB Packaging Technology
- Ultra-Light and Thin
COB screens use customizable PCB thicknesses, reducing weight to as little as one-third of traditional displays. This cuts costs for structure, transportation, and installation. - Anti-Collision and Durable
LED chips are embedded in a recessed PCB position and sealed with epoxy resin, creating a smooth, hard, impact-resistant surface that withstands wear and tear. - Superior Heat Dissipation
Heat from the LED chips is efficiently transferred through the PCBâs copper layer, minimizing light degradation and extending the screenâs lifespan. - Wear-Resistant and Easy to Maintain
The smooth, durable surface is easy to clean, and any defective pixels can be repaired individually, ensuring low maintenance costs. - All-Weather Performance
With triple protection against water, moisture, corrosion, dust, static electricity, oxidation, and UV rays, COB screens excel in diverse environmental conditions.
Real-World Applications of COB Technology
COB technology is driving innovation across various sectors, particularly in small-pitch LED displays like P0.78âP1.87 models. These displays feature magnetic module designs for wall-mounted installation, space efficiency, and reliable operation. With point-by-point calibration, high refresh rates, high grayscale, and excellent contrast, COB displays deliver flawless visuals.
1. Security Monitoring and Command Centers
COB displays are the preferred choice for command and control centers due to their ultra-high-definition and reliability. For instance, the Three Gorges Group Command Center uses inverted COB small-pitch displays to enhance information clarity, improving monitoring, dispatching, and water environment management efficiency.
2. Commercial Advertising and Monitoring
In commercial settings, COB screensâ high brightness and contrast make them ideal for outdoor billboards and indoor advertising. The Guangdong Transportation Groupâs monitoring center, for example, uses COB ultra-high-definition screens to boost operational monitoring and attract attention with stunning visuals. Similarly, General Motorsâ smart display center employs flip-chip COB displays for business operation visualization and multi-application displays.
3. Smart Conferences and Public Spaces
COB displays shine in smart conference rooms and educational settings with their high-definition visuals and vivid image quality. Quantum dot COB all-in-one systems, using advanced nanopore quantum dot crystal technology, offer lower screen temperatures and higher efficiency, creating comfortable and effective visual experiences. The 320Ă160 standard module COB display is widely used in public spaces for its versatility and performance.
4. Rail Transit and Public Stations
In rail transit, COB screens excel with their ultra-high-definition visuals and robust protection. Shenzhen Metro Line 14, for example, uses fully flip-chip COB small-pitch LED displays, which provide excellent image quality, efficient heat dissipation, and long-term reliability, enhancing passenger safety and comfort.
